Abstract

The utility model discloses a solid-liquid separation device for detecting fried food, which comprises supporting legs and a shell, wherein the supporting legs are installed at the bottom end of the shell, a discharge hole penetrates through the center of the bottom end of the shell, a valve is arranged at the left end of the discharge hole, a feed hole penetrates through the top end of the shell, a scraping device is arranged at the top end of the shell, a filter screen is arranged in the shell and is fixedly connected with the shell through a fixed block, the scraping device is added on the solid-liquid separation device for detecting fried food, a scraping plate is added in the newly added scraping device, a handle is arranged at the top end of the scraping plate, so that solid on the filter screen can be scraped to one side in real time when filtering and separating are carried out, the filter screen is prevented from being blocked by the solid, the falling speed of the oil can be accelerated, and the detection is prevented from being influenced by the blockage of the filter screen, and then the overall detection efficiency can be improved.

Technical Field
The utility model belongs to the technical field related to solid-liquid separation devices, and particularly relates to a solid-liquid separation device for detecting fried foods.
Background
The food safety detection is used for detecting harmful substances in food according to national indexes, and mainly used for detecting harmful and toxic indexes, such as heavy metal, aflatoxin and the like. An important aspect of food science and engineering is the introduction and use of chemical unit operations and the development of food engineering unit operations, thereby promoting the development of the food industry towards large-scale, continuous and automated.
The existing solid-liquid separation device for detecting fried food has the following problems: the existing solid-liquid separation device for detecting the fried food is mainly used for separating oil, the whole solid-liquid separation device for detecting the fried food is mainly realized by a filter screen, although the separation effect can be realized by the filter screen, the oil is more viscous when the device is used, so that the separation efficiency is particularly low if solids are attached to the filter screen when the device is used, the separation time is prolonged when the device is used, and the next detection is not facilitated.
